数据库模型线条设计是什么

worktile 其他 5

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库模型线条设计是指在数据库设计过程中,对数据库中的实体和实体之间的关系进行建模和设计的过程。线条设计是指用线条来表示实体和关系之间的连接和联系。

    1. 实体建模:线条设计中的第一步是对数据库中的实体进行建模。实体是指在数据库中具有独立存在和属性的对象,可以是一个人、一个物品、一个地点等等。通过建模可以确定实体的属性和关联关系,为后续的数据库设计提供基础。

    2. 关系建模:线条设计的第二步是对实体之间的关系进行建模。关系是指实体之间的联系和连接,可以是一对一、一对多、多对多等不同类型的关系。通过建模可以确定关系的类型和属性,为后续的数据库设计提供指导。

    3. 线条表示:线条设计使用线条来表示实体和关系之间的连接和联系。在实体建模中,可以使用直线或箭头线来表示实体之间的关系;在关系建模中,可以使用菱形线条来表示多对多关系,使用直线或箭头线来表示一对一或一对多关系。

    4. 约束和规范:线条设计还包括对数据库的约束和规范的定义。通过线条设计,可以确定实体和关系之间的约束条件,如唯一性约束、外键约束等,以保证数据库的数据完整性和一致性。

    5. 可视化工具:线条设计通常使用可视化工具进行,如ER图、UML图等。这些工具可以帮助设计人员更直观地理解和呈现数据库模型的线条设计,方便沟通和交流。

    总结起来,数据库模型线条设计是对数据库中实体和关系进行建模和设计的过程,使用线条来表示实体和关系之间的连接和联系。通过线条设计,可以确定实体和关系的属性和关系类型,定义约束和规范,并使用可视化工具进行呈现和交流。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库模型线条设计是指在数据库设计过程中,确定实体之间的关系和连接方式的一种方法。它用于描述数据库中各个表之间的联系,包括一对一、一对多和多对多等关系。通过合理的线条设计,可以清晰地表示不同实体之间的联系和依赖关系,为数据库的正常运行和数据的准确性提供了基础。

    在数据库模型线条设计中,常用的线条类型有三种:实线、虚线和箭头线。实线一般表示一对一或者一对多的关系,虚线表示多对多的关系,而箭头线则表示依赖关系。通过使用这些线条类型,可以清晰地表示不同实体之间的关系,并且有助于理解数据库模型的结构。

    线条设计的目的是为了使数据库模型的结构更加清晰和易于理解。通过合理的线条设计,可以帮助数据库开发人员和用户更好地理解数据库的结构和功能,从而更加方便地进行数据库的操作和管理。此外,线条设计还可以帮助数据库管理员和开发人员进行数据库的维护和优化工作,提高数据库的性能和效率。

    在进行数据库模型线条设计时,需要考虑以下几个方面:

    1. 实体之间的关系:确定不同实体之间的关系类型,包括一对一、一对多和多对多等关系。根据实际需求和业务规则,选择合适的关系类型来表示实体之间的联系。

    2. 线条类型的选择:根据实体之间的关系类型,选择合适的线条类型来表示这种关系。实线、虚线和箭头线都有各自的含义和用途,需要根据实际情况进行选择。

    3. 线条的位置和方向:线条的位置和方向也是线条设计的重要考虑因素。根据实体之间的关系和依赖关系,合理安排线条的位置和方向,使得数据库模型的结构更加清晰和易于理解。

    通过合理的数据库模型线条设计,可以提高数据库的可读性和可维护性,减少错误和冲突的发生,从而提高数据库的性能和效率。在进行线条设计时,需要充分考虑实际需求和业务规则,合理选择线条类型和位置,确保数据库模型的结构和功能与实际需求相符。同时,随着业务的发展和需求的变化,数据库模型线条设计也需要及时进行调整和优化,以保持数据库的稳定性和可扩展性。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库模型线条设计是指在数据库设计过程中,通过使用线条和箭头来表示实体之间的关系。它是一种图形化的方式,用于描述数据库中实体(表)之间的联系和依赖关系。在数据库模型线条设计中,通常使用的两种图形表示方法是实体关系图(ER图)和UML类图。

    在数据库模型线条设计中,主要包括以下几个方面:

    1. 实体(表):实体是数据库中的一个具体的对象,可以是现实世界中的一个事物或概念。每个实体都有自己的属性(字段),用于描述该实体的特征。

    2. 关系:关系是实体之间的联系,表示实体之间的依赖关系或关联关系。常见的关系有一对一关系、一对多关系和多对多关系。

    3. 线条和箭头:线条和箭头用于表示实体之间的关系。在ER图中,通常使用实线表示一对一关系,箭头表示一对多关系,菱形表示多对多关系。在UML类图中,通常使用实线和箭头表示一对一关系和一对多关系。

    4. 属性(字段):属性是实体的特征,用于描述实体的属性或状态。每个实体都有自己的属性集合,属性可以是字符串、数字、日期等类型。

    在进行数据库模型线条设计时,可以按照以下流程进行操作:

    1. 确定需求:首先明确数据库的需求,包括需要存储的数据和数据之间的关系。

    2. 绘制实体关系图:根据需求,使用ER图或UML类图的方式,绘制实体之间的关系。根据实体之间的关系,使用适当的线条和箭头表示。

    3. 设计表结构:根据实体关系图,设计数据库的表结构。确定每个表的字段(属性)和数据类型,并确定主键和外键。

    4. 创建表:根据表结构设计,使用SQL语句或数据库设计工具创建数据库表。

    5. 添加数据:根据需求,向数据库表中添加数据。

    6. 测试和优化:对数据库进行测试,确保数据的准确性和完整性。根据需要,对数据库进行优化,提高查询性能。

    总结:数据库模型线条设计是数据库设计过程中的重要环节,通过使用线条和箭头表示实体之间的关系,可以清晰地描述数据库的结构和关系。在进行数据库模型线条设计时,需要明确需求,绘制实体关系图,设计表结构,创建表并添加数据,最后进行测试和优化。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部